Some GMC Envoy XL owners report experiencing low oil pressure warning lights, particularly when idling or at a stop. This warning can be triggered by a low engine oil level, which should be checked first. Additionally, a faulty oil pressure sensor may lead to inaccurate readings, causing the warning light to activate. Issues with the oil pressure valve can also restrict oil flow, contributing to the warning. Some owners find that low idle speeds can cause the low oil pressure warning to appear, highlighting the importance of maintaining proper idle levels. Furthermore, a drop in oil pressure may indicate problems within the engine's lubrication system, which should be addressed promptly to avoid potential engine damage. If the warning persists after these checks, it is recommended that owners seek a professional mechanic for a thorough inspection to identify the root cause of the issue.
